- Abstract
- The change of various devices according to the development of technology has affected the way of life in general, and the change of this way has also changed the user's emotional state about the space. Recently, the development of virtual reality technology by the 4th industrial revolution has helped to grasp the user's spatial satisfaction in relation to the space planning, and research is being conducted to reflect the human emotional state in space in connection with the EEG. Therefore, the purpose of this study is to propose a window control using parametric technique controlled by user's stress index based on EEG in virtual reality.
